Job Summary
The Regional Communications Lead will work collaboratively with University of Kentucky staff and community members to implement the HEALing Communities Study (HCS), a federal grant that aims to reduce opioid overdose deaths by 40 percent in participating communities. Work will require collaboration with and travel to and around up to four HCS communities, which include Bourbon, Carter, Jefferson, Knox, Campbell, Greenup, Jefferson, and Mason counties. The Regional Communications Lead will support HCS study teams and communities as they implement health communication campaigns focused on opioid overdose education and naloxone distribution (OEND), medications for opioid use disorder (MOUD), safe disposal of unused medications, and stigma. Support will include attending study team and community meetings (both virtual and in-person), building partnerships and supporting partner campaign implementation, distributing campaign materials to partner agencies and within the community, supporting outreach events and OEND trainings, management of social media pages, and contributing to evaluation, reports, and presentations.

Be advised that this is currently a one (1) year grant funded position.
